Patent No. EP3714719 (titled "Aerosol Delivery Device With Improved Fluid Transport") was filed by RAI Strategic on Jan 4, 2017. The application was issued on May 14, 2025.
Electronic cigarette with improved aerosol delivery by using porous monolithic materials like porous glass or ceramic for the reservoir and liquid transport element. This allows better wicking and vaporization of the e-liquid compared to traditional wicking materials. The porous monoliths have high surface area and pore structure that absorbs and transports the e-liquid efficiently to the heating element.
